The equilibrium phase diagram of a two-dimensional Ising model with competing exchange and dipolar interactions is analyzed using a Monte Carlo simulation technique. We consider the low temperature region of the (delta,T) phase diagram (delta being the ratio between the strengths of the exchange and dipolar interactions) for the range of values of delta where striped phases with widths h=1 and h=2 are present. We show that the transition line between both phases is a first order one. We also show that, associated with the first order phase transition, there appear metastable states of the phase h=2 in the region where the phase h=1 is the thermodynamically stable one and viceversa.
